A lot of the detail work on Avion truck campers is top notch. But windows have come a long way since 1970. After extensive work resealing and reenforcing many of our camper's seams, one of the few remaining leak points is the windows. The current windows along the body are split into two panes. The larger top pane does not open. An understandable choice given that the surface these windows are built on is curved. Framing out a curved window pain and frame that opens and is fit for weather and highway durability would be a huge challenge. So, only the lower pain opens. It is a section just low enough for the pain to be flat. But this also means it is a very small opening: just enough for a little venting.

Out in the remote California desert, a debate between art, graffiti, and history rages in slow motion at the Fish Rocks (aka "Whale Rocks" or "Fish Head Rocks,"). These painted rocks off highway 178 trace their origins back to the 1930s. Since then, the question of art vs. graffiti has swirled long enough around this rock outcropping. In the 1970s, the fish faces along with other graffiti that had accumulated over the decades were painted over to restore the natural look of the rocks. Yet, the fish faces prevail as various visitors have restored the fish faces through the years.
